### About ALSETLab
ALSETLab is the name of Luigi's research group and also the real-time hardware-in-the-loop laboratory being built at RPI. The acronym stands for (ALSET: Analysis Laboratory for Synchrophasor and Electrical energy Technology) and (Lab: for Lab).
